What topics are covered in home economics?

Home economics, or family and consumer sciences, is today a subject concerning human development, personal and family finance, housing and interior design, food science and preparation, nutrition and wellness, textiles and apparel, and consumer issues.

What are the 3 components of home economics?

Home economics has three major components; home management, food and nutrition as well as fashion and fabrics. Under home management, there are a number of components that include cookery, laundry, health education and house craft.

What is Home Economics class called now?

It’s a common question. But home ec has not disappeared, it’s changed, evolving into classes focusing on child development, nutrition, family health, food service and hospitality. In fact, in California, home ec is still called home ec; it’s the only state in the nation that has kept the name.

What are the aims of the Junior Certificate home economics?

The aims of Junior Certificate Home Economics are – to provide pupils with knowledge and practical skills for application in the process of everyday life within the home and community. – to ensure that pupils will be capable of wise decision-making in areas related to the management of their personal resources.
